(1)
Tested during VOH/VOL tests by applying appropriate voltage levels to the input pins of the device under test.
(2)
The VCMR range is reduced for larger VID. Example: if VID = 400mV, the VCMR is 0.2V to 2.2V. The fail-safe condition with inputs
shorted is valid over a common-mode range of 0V to 2.3V. A VID up to VCC − 0V may be applied to the RIN+/ RI− inputs with the
Common-Mode voltage set to VCC/2. Propagation delay and Differential Pulse skew decrease when VID is increased from 200mV to
400mV. Skew specifications apply for 200mV
≤ VID ≤ 800mV over the common-mode range .
(3)
Output short circuit current (IOS) is specified as magnitude only, minus sign indicates direction only. Only one output should be shorted
at a time, do not exceed maximum junction temperature.
(4)
Tested during IOZ tests by applying appropriate threshold voltage levels to the En and En* pins.
